TIDMPYF RNS Number : 7409Q PolyFuel Inc. 17 April 2009 17 April 2009 PolyFuel, Inc. $2.5m development funding from US Department of Energy PolyFuel, Inc (AIM: PYF), a world leader in fuel cell technology and engineered fuel cell membranes for the portable electronics industry, is pleased to announce that the US Department of Energy has awarded the Company with $2.5m in funding for its portable fuel cell development programme. The funding is part of President Obama's American Recovery and Reinvestment Act, and will be provided over 3 years. The new award follows on from a previous DOE program award in which PolyFuel developed a demonstration prototype of a portable fuel cell power supply for a notebook PC. During that previous program, PolyFuel significantly advanced the state of the art of direct methanol fuel cell (DMFC) technology by developing a novel membrane and membrane electrode assembly (MEA). These new materials enabled a simplification in the design of the overall fuel cell system, and the elimination of a number of system components for a substantial reduction in system size, weight and cost. The objective of the new program is to advance the technology further to meet the goals for performance, durability, and cost that the DOE has established for widescale commercial adoption of DMFC technology for use in laptops and other portable electronics devices. Specifically, PolyFuel proposes to further integrate and miniaturize the components and subsystems to increase the power density and energy density of the overall DMFC system. Further, by employing a technique referred to as design failure modes and effects analysis (DFMEA), along with extensive testing to failure of redesigned components and subsystems, PolyFuel will increase system durability to achieve that required for commercialization. Finally, PolyFuel, with the assistance of its consumer electronics customers/partners will conduct a design for manufacturability and assembly (DFMA) review of the system, subsystems, and components to ensure that they meet the cost targets for ultimate commercialization. In addition to this grant, PolyFuel is continuing to actively seek additional capital to complete its technology and product development, build out its manufacturing capability, and achieve commercial introduction of its products. PolyFuel president and CEO Jim Balcom said: "We are delighted with the DOE's continued backing of portable fuel cell technology. This grant is a solid validation of the strength of PolyFuel's capability and technology, supporting our belief that our materials and systems technology represents a significant advancement for the portable power market and is the leading technology available to the industry today."
